Ingredients:
 89 lbs fully cooked spiral ham
 1 cup water
For the Glaze:
 ½ cup Ginger Evans Brown Sugar
 ½ cup Tipton Grove Apple Cider
 1 tbsp Kurtz Apple Cider Vinegar
 1 tbsp Kurtz Dijon Mustard
 ½ tsp Marcum Allspice
 ¼ tsp Marcum Ground Clove
 ¼ tsp Marcum Ground Cinnamon
 Pinch Marcum Ground Nutmeg
1

Preheat oven to 300 ° Place ham cut side down in a roasting pan and add water to the bottom of the pan. Cover ham with foil and bake for 1 hour and 40 minutes, or until internal temperature reaches 135 °F.

2

Meanwhile, make the glaze. Combine all glaze ingredients in a small saucepan and bring to a simmer over low heat. Simmer and stir until sauce has thickened and reduced to ½ cup, about 8-10 minutes. Remove from heat.

3

Once ham has heated through, remove from oven. Increase oven temperature to 400 ° Brush glaze over surface and return to oven, uncovered, for 10 minutes or until glaze is caramelized.

4

Allow ham to rest for 10 minutes before serving.
